Transaction 14315847f8c2874c4de1a31dbe73cb7754cac6f8996c93a873ca9efd80ecfeb3

100 Input
1 Outputs
  • 14315847f8c2874c4de1a31dbe73cb7754cac6f8996c93a873ca9efd80ecfeb3:0
  • value  96493991
    address  3H9WXKYPqq4xo3ahuQvEDcDJBgFJcxGLpJ